Subscriber-level stored script injection via unchecked AJAX handlers
Published Nov 8, 2025 · Updated Nov 8, 2025
Missing authorization in Neofix Simple Downloads List 1.4.3 and earlier allows remote authenticated users to inject stored web scripts. The wp_ajax_neofix_sdl_edit AJAX handler and other plugin handlers accept download and settings changes without checking the caller's WordPress capability. Subscriber-level access is sufficient to alter plugin settings or downloads; injected scripts execute when affected content is viewed.
